Key Ingredients
- 🐷 4 boneless pork chops (about 1 inch thick)
- 🧀 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 🌿 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
- 🧄 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 🥚 1 large egg, lightly beaten
- 🍞 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
- 🧂 1 teaspoon salt
- 🌶️ 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 🧈 2 tablespoons olive oil
Instructions
1️⃣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Lightly grease a baking dish.
2️⃣ In a shallow dish, whisk together the beaten egg, minced garlic, salt, and pepper.
3️⃣ In a separate shallow dish, combine the grated Parmesan cheese, breadcrumbs, and chopped parsley.
4️⃣ Dip each pork chop into the egg mixture, ensuring it’s fully coated.
5️⃣ Dredge each egg-coated pork chop thoroughly in the Parmesan mixture, pressing gently to adhere the crust.
6️⃣ Place the coated pork chops in the prepared baking dish, drizzle with olive oil.
7️⃣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the pork chops are cooked through and the crust is golden brown and crispy. Internal temperature should reach 145°F (63°C).
8️⃣ Let the pork chops rest for 5 minutes before serving.
Handy Tips
- For extra crispy crust, broil the pork chops for the last 2-3 minutes of baking, keeping a close eye to prevent burning.
- Using high-quality Parmesan cheese significantly enhances the flavor of the dish.
- Don’t overcrowd the baking dish; allow space between the chops for even browning.
Heat Control
Maintaining the oven temperature at 400°F (200°C) is crucial for achieving the perfect balance of crispy crust and tender pork. Too low, and the pork may be dry; too high, and the crust will burn before the pork is cooked through.

Flavor Variations
🌟 Lemon Herb: Add the zest and juice of one lemon to the egg mixture. Incorporate dried herbs like thyme and rosemary into the breadcrumb mixture.
🌟 Spicy Parmesan: Incorporate a pinch of cayenne pepper or a dash of your favorite hot sauce into the breadcrumb mixture for a spicy twist.
🌟 Mushroom Medley: Sauté a mix of wild mushrooms before baking and arrange them around the pork chops in the baking dish.
🌟 Asiago and Walnut: Replace some of the Parmesan with Asiago cheese and add chopped walnuts to the breadcrumb mixture for a nutty, sophisticated flavor profile.
Troubleshooting
- Dry Pork Chops: Ensure the pork chops are not overcooked.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ature.
- Burnt Crust: Reduce the oven temperature slightly or watch closely during the last few minutes of baking, especially if broiling.
- Soggy Crust: Ensure the pork chops are completely dry before dipping them in the egg mixture.
FAQ
- Can I use bone-in pork chops? Yes, but you may need to adjust the baking time accordingly. Check the internal temperature to ensure they are cooked through.
- Can I prepare this ahead of time? You can prepare the pork chops up to the point of baking and refrigerate them until ready to cook.
- What other cheeses can I use? Asiago, Pecorino Romano, or a blend of hard cheeses would be excellent substitutes for Parmesan.

Decadent Parmesan-Crusted Pork Chops: A Culinary Masterpiece
Indulge in these succulent pork chops, perfectly seasoned and coated with a crispy Parmesan crust for a delightful crunch.
Ingredients
- 4 bone-in pork chops
- 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 cup breadcrumbs
- 2 large eggs
- 2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Fresh parsley for garnish
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 190u00b0C (375u00b0F).
- In a bowl, whisk together the eggs and Dijon mustard until well combined.
- In another bowl, combine the grated Parmesan cheese, breadcrumbs,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per.
- Dip each pork chop into the egg mixture, then coat thoroughly with the Parmesan breadcrumb mixture.
-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at and sear each pork chop for 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own.
- Transfer the seared pork chops to a baking dish and b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es or until the internal temperature reaches 63u00b0C (145u00b0F).
- Remove from the oven and let rest for 5 minutes before serving.
- Garnish with fresh parsley and serve hot.
